Background
The submersible pump is an important device for pumping water from a deep well. When in use, the whole unit is submerged to work, and underground water is extracted to the ground surface, so that the unit is used for domestic water, mine emergency, industrial cooling, farmland irrigation, seawater lifting and ship load regulation, and can also be used for fountain landscape.
When the existing submersible pump is used, the bottom filter screen part is contacted with the bottom sludge, the sludge is easily wrapped, the water pumping treatment of the submersible pump is blocked, the blockage of the submersible pump is caused, and the submersible pump is easily damaged.

The working principle is as follows: when the floating type anti-blocking submersible pump is used, firstly, the submersible pump main body 1 is lifted by the lifting handle 2, the submersible pump main body 1 is placed under water, the upper part of the submersible pump main body 1 can float on the water surface by the first buoyancy barrel 4 and the second buoyancy barrel 9, the lower part of the submersible pump main body 1 is positioned in the water, the bottom sinking time of the submersible pump main body 1 is reduced, when the submersible pump main body 1 is pumped, the lower end of the submersible pump main body 1 is prevented from being wrapped by the sludge at the water bottom for a long time, the first buoyancy barrel 4 and the second buoyancy barrel 9 are movably connected with the fixing ring 10 through the connecting lug 5, the first buoyancy barrel 4 and the second buoyancy barrel 9 can float relative to the submersible pump main body 1, the positioning clamp 3 plays a role in stably connecting the fixing ring 10 with the submersible pump main body 1, when the submersible pump main body 1 is pumped, water enters the anti-blocking mechanism 8 from the outer filter screen 15, then enters the base 11 through the inner filter screen 12, finally the water is discharged from the drain pipe connected on the drain pipe fixing seat 7, the inner filter screen 12 and the outer filter screen 15 play a role in filtering the water, so that impurities such as aquatic weeds are reduced to enter the submersible pump main body 1, the mounting seat 13 plays a role in connecting and fixing the anti-blocking mechanism 8 and the base 11, when the water is shallow, the submersible pump main body 1 is placed in a sludge position, the driving motor 17 drives the driving connecting shaft 18 to drive the anti-blocking scraper 14 and the cleaning brush 16 to rotate under the power supply of the battery 20, the sludge outside the outer filter screen 15 is scraped by the anti-blocking scraper 14, the cleaning brush 16 cleans and removes the sludge at the mesh position of the outer filter screen 15, the outer filter screen 15 can smoothly pass water, so as to prevent the water from entering the submersible pump main body 1 from being blocked, the waterproof cover 19 plays a role in waterproof protection treatment on the driving motor 17 and the battery 20, thereby completing a series of works.
